Step 2: Understanding the Sudoku Grid and Rules

Once your sudoku app is installed, it’s time to learn the basics. Each standard puzzle features a 9×9 grid, subdivided into nine 3×3 blocks. The goal? Fill every cell with a number from 1 to 9—without repeating a digit in any row, column, or block.

If you’re new to the rules or visualizing the grid, many sudoku apps offer built-in tutorials and visual aids. For a comprehensive breakdown of the grid, rules, and example puzzles, check out this How to Play Sudoku on Mobile guide.

Key Points:

  • Each puzzle starts with some numbers filled in.
  • Use logic—not guessing—to determine which numbers fit.
  • Most sudoku apps highlight errors or duplicate numbers to help you learn as you play.

Mastering the Basics: Logic and Elimination

Every sudoku app relies on the same foundational rules: each row, column, and 3×3 block must contain the numbers 1–9 without repeats. Start by scanning for the most obvious placements—look for rows or columns where only one number is missing. This logical elimination process is the bedrock for solving even the trickiest puzzles.

Use the built-in note or memo feature in your sudoku app to jot down possible numbers for each empty cell. Cross-hatching—where you systematically check which numbers are missing in intersecting rows and columns—can quickly narrow your options. Avoid guessing; instead, let logic guide your moves. With practice, these basics become second nature, and you’ll find yourself solving puzzles more efficiently.

Advanced Techniques for Challenging Puzzles

As you progress, you'll encounter puzzles that demand more than just the basics. Advanced techniques like naked pairs/triples, hidden pairs/triples, and pointing pairs help you spot patterns that aren’t immediately obvious. For example, if only two cells in a row can be a certain pair of numbers, those numbers can’t appear elsewhere in that row.

For especially tough challenges, methods like X-Wing and Swordfish come into play. These rely on recognizing patterns across rows and columns—skills that separate casual players from experts. Common Advanced Techniques Table

Technique Description When to Use
Naked Pairs Two cells in a unit share candidates; eliminate elsewhere When pairs appear
Hidden Triples Three cells in a unit have three shared candidates Complex, sparse puzzles
X-Wing Numbers align in two rows/columns; eliminate others High-difficulty puzzles
